File photo taken on April 10, 2016 shows Polish Prime Minister Beata Szydlo attends a commemoration of the sixth anniversary of plane catastrophe in Smolensk, in Warsaw, Poland. Polish Prime Minister Beata Szydlo handed in her resignation from the post to the political committee of the ruling Law and Justice (PiS). The resignation was accepted, PiS spokesperson, Beata Mazurek, informed during a press conference held on Dec. 7, 2017. (Xinhua/Chen Xu)
